SED and teaming partners experience includes designing and implementing Community
Solar Programs for the cities of Roseville, Shasta Lake, Santa Clara, Glendale,
Anaheim, Redding, Palo Alto, Vallejo, and Lompoc.

- As the Roseville’s PV consultant of record, provide a full range of technical and
program support for Roseville’s BEST Home Program (Blueprint for Energy Efficiency
and Solar Technology), which aims to build 4,000 solar homes in ten years for 8
MW of solar power.
